Last Season
82 games, 14 goals and 7 assists for 21 points, 2 shorthanded, 30 penalty minutes, 12:31 a night and minus-3, with 1 game-winner. He took 41.8 per cent of the expected goals at five-on-five over 944 minutes, the 15th percentile, and his ice went 24-31 against an expectation of 29.37-40.90.
Five goals of finishing below what the chances were worth and ten goals of goaltending above them. Fourteen goals from a fourth-line winger at twelve and a half minutes a night is a real return.
The Finesse Game
140 attempts at a median of 15 feet with 61 per cent of them from inside twenty, 109 of those on goal, converted at 12.3 per cent against a career 10.70 across 243 shots.
Zero power-play goals in 179 career games. Sixty-one per cent of his attempts from inside twenty feet is the closest shot chart on the club; at 6-6 he simply stands where the puck is going to be and nobody can move him out of it.
The Physical Game
He is 6-6 and 225 and took 30 penalty minutes.
Fifty-seven career penalty minutes in 179 games is a strikingly low total for a man that size. He forechecks with the frame and finishes checks without reaching, and there is no fighting or retaliation in his game at all.
The Intangibles
One hundred and thirteenth overall in 2017 by St. Louis, three seasons, one organisation, and 42 points in 179 games.
Three career shorthanded goals, two of them last season. He was a fourth-round pick who is 6-6, kills penalties and scores fourteen goals from the paint, which is a fourth-line player any club would take.

With and without
| Teammate | Together | Him apart | Mate apart |
|---|---|---|---|
| Kevin Hayes | 42.0% | 41.6% | 46.0% |
| Colton Parayko | 41.5% | 42.0% | 45.1% |
| Nick Leddy | 39.3% | 43.4% | 45.9% |
42.0% together, 41.6% for him apart and 46.0% for Hayes apart. Hayes was better away from him while his own share held, which is a mark against him more than for him.
Expected-goal share while both were on the ice, and for each man in the minutes he played without the other. Apart is the pair subtracted from his own totals. It does not settle who was carrying whom — apart from each other, both were still playing with somebody — but it does say whether the share travelled when the pairing broke up.
Where he shoots from
goal on goal missed
140 unblocked shots in 2023-24, 14 of them goals. His median goal came from 13 feet. 61% of his shots came from inside twenty feet, 19% from beyond forty.
